The Neural Impulse: Using Energy to Send Information pg75
• Neuron At Rest
-The Neuron at rest is a small battery, from the uneven Ion charges from the fluid around it of Sodium (Na) and Potassium (K).
-Resting Potential – The Stable, Negative Charge when the Cell is inactive.
•The Action Potential
- Action Potential – A very brief shift in a Neuron’s electrical charge that travels along an axon.

1. Summarize the document in two to three sentences. What does it/the author say?

2. Who produced the document? Discuss the author's age, ethnicity, social status, religion, intellectual or political philosophy, etc..

3. When was it produced? Can it be connected with a significant historical event?

4. Who was the intended audience? Was the document written privately, written to be read, or heard by others (if so, who?), an official document for a ruler to read, commission painting, etc..
